Transaction 8355f60f9d5b450c33834d835342af4fa91998352057f65c9f6d30479977991b
1 Input
2 Outputs
- 8355f60f9d5b450c33834d835342af4fa91998352057f65c9f6d30479977991b:0
- 8355f60f9d5b450c33834d835342af4fa91998352057f65c9f6d30479977991b:1
value 3544959
address 1MtiKc83QbsnydX2CBZx9CZcBeBD9tkgkA
value 42304468
address 18LwSXdFUn7L1tzEiHhubmbRtwqYwwWcfE